Pair your pasta with the perfect wine

Not sure what wine to serve with your pasta dish? A good rule of thumb is to match the sauce with the wine. So, for example, a rich and creamy Alfredo sauce would go well with a Chardonnay, while a light tomato sauce would be better paired with a Pinot Noir.

If you have a red sauce, go for a red wine like Merlot or Cabernet Sauvignon. If you have a white sauce, opt for white wine.
